description The TEA2376DT is a digital configurable two-phase interleaved PFC controller for high-efficiency power supplies. The PFC operates in discontinuous conduction mode or quasi-resonant mode with valley switching to optimize efficiency. The TEA2376DT enables the building of an interleaved power factor controller, which is easy to design with a low external ponent count. The TEA2376DT is available in a low profile and narrow body-width SO14. The digital architecture of the TEA2376DT is based on a high-speed configurable hardware state machine ensuring reliable real-time performance. To meet specific application requirements, many operation and protection settings of the PFC controller can be adjusted by loading new settings into the device with I2C during power supply development.
